A 50-person meeting or training day is the most popular size for mid-size companies — serious enough to matter, small enough to manage without a full events team. The decisions procurement actually has to make are few: the real number of people who will show up, the per-head budget, 2–3 menu options, and the confirmation deadline. This checklist is ordered by the timeline you work to.

Where people slip up most

Getting the headcount wrong is the number one cause of leftover or missing food — count confirmed attendees, not registrations, and add a 5–10% buffer for staff and last-minute participants. But be decisive: confirm the final number clearly before 15:00 on the business day before delivery.

7-item checklist for a 50-person company meeting

☐ 1. Count real attendees and add a 5–10% buffer
Count people who have confirmed attendance, then add a buffer for staff and walk-ins on the day — for example, 45 confirmed → book 48–50 boxes.

☐ 3. Pick 2–3 menus with different proteins
No group of 50 ever likes the same food — pair Thai with Indian menus, or mix popular items with one premium option. ☐ 6. Give precise drop-off details
Share the address, floor/meeting room, and the time window for delivery — at least 15 minutes before the scheduled lunch break.

☐ 7. Add drinks or snacks if the budget allows
Bottled water or light snacks make the meal feel complete — ask for them on the same quotation.
